
Ashfaq Ahmed (Urdu: اشفاق
احمد) (22 August 1925 – 7 September 2004) was a writer, playwright,
broadcaster, intellectual and spiritualist from Pakistan. He was regarded by
many as among the finest Urdu Afsana (short-story) writers alongside Saadat
Hasan Manto, Qurratulain Hyder, Prem Chand, Bedi, Mirza Adeeb, Ismat Chughtai and
Krishan Chander following the publication of his short-story Gaddarya
